我的DBMail安装最终可以接收邮件,但只能从本地主机接收。我可以做telnet localhost 24和telnet localhost 143,成功登录。我也可以从24端口发送邮件到我的一个电子邮件帐户。但是,当我从另一台服务器发送邮件时,它将不会被发送到我的电子邮件帐户。好消息:我没有收到像E-mail is not delivered这样的邮件。
我在从我的dockarized应用程序访问mysql服务器时遇到了麻烦。我可以在workbenceh中正常使用localhost, port 3307, password, user and database访问数据库,所以我假设我可以在我的nodejs应用程序中这样做,但可以使用Mysql服务器已经准备好在nodejs启动之前进行连接,并且正在监听3306。我有正确的用户拥有正确的特权..。我真的不知道现在我错过了什么。/mysql
env_file
我的连接参数是正确的,因为我使用成功地连接了mysqli。但是自从切换到PDO后,我遇到了麻烦,并且总是抛出异常Unknown MySQL server host。我的相关代码如下: public function __construct(){ $connection= new PDO('mysql:host=localhost:8889;dbname=mydatabasename',